CFAR Summer Conference
Harm, Abuse and Betrayal
Speakers include Katherine Angel, Devorah Baum, Darian Leader, Jamieson Webster
Harm, abuse and betrayal are three forms of violence that may be experienced as fused, as separate or as interlinked together. A patient might describe receiving acute physical harm yet what matters more may be how a witness failed to intervene. Both action and non-action can constitute violence, just as harm may be directed both to and away from the self. What shapes these forces, and how are they connected to the loyalties that are forged in our early childhoods? How do these then function later in life, in the unions and partnerships that we might commit to or seek to avoid?
